My Buying Guide on ‘Best Travel Purse With Water Bottle Holder’
When I travel, one of the essentials I can’t live without is a good travel purse, especially one that can accommodate a water bottle. Staying hydrated on the go is crucial, and having a designated holder for my water bottle makes life so much easier. If you’re in the market for a travel purse with a water bottle holder, let me share my insights and experiences to help you make the best choice.
1. Size and Capacity
When choosing a travel purse, size matters. I’ve found that a medium-sized purse typically works best for my needs. It should be big enough to hold my essentials—like my wallet, phone, and travel documents—while still being compact enough to carry comfortably. A purse with a separate compartment for a water bottle is a game-changer; I prefer one that can fit a standard-sized bottle without compromising the overall space.
2. Comfort and Style
I believe that a travel purse should be both comfortable and stylish. Look for features like adjustable straps and padded handles that make it easy to carry around all day. I tend to lean towards purses that offer a blend of functionality and style. Whether I’m exploring a new city or dining out, I want my purse to complement my outfit while serving its purpose.
3. Durability and Material
Travel can be tough on bags, so I always check the material before making a purchase. I prefer purses made from water-resistant or durable fabrics, like nylon or canvas, as they withstand the rigors of travel better. A sturdy bag not only protects my belongings but also ensures the purse lasts for multiple trips.
4. Organizational Features
I value organization in my travel purse. Look for compartments and pockets that allow easy access to your items. A designated pocket for the water bottle is essential, but I also appreciate smaller pockets for my phone, keys, and passport. This way, I can keep everything in its place and avoid the dreaded rummaging through a messy bag.
5. Security Features
When I travel, keeping my belongings secure is a top priority. I recommend looking for purses with zippers, magnetic closures, or even anti-theft features. A bag with RFID-blocking technology is a plus, as it helps protect my credit cards and personal information from electronic pickpocketing.
6. Versatility
I find that a versatile travel purse can be used for various occasions. A bag that can transition from day trips to evening outings is ideal. Consider whether the purse can be worn crossbody or as a shoulder bag, as this flexibility can enhance comfort and style.
7. Price Range
Budget is always a factor when I shop for travel accessories. Travel purses come in a wide range of prices, and I’ve found that you don’t always have to break the bank for quality. Set a budget before you start shopping, and consider both high-end and budget-friendly options. There are excellent choices available at all price points.
8. Customer Reviews
Before making a final decision, I always check customer reviews. Hearing about other people’s experiences can provide valuable insights into the purse’s functionality, durability, and overall satisfaction. Look for feedback regarding the water bottle holder and how well it performs during travel.
